YNAB (You Required a Budget plan) utilizes the zero-based budgeting technique, which indicates you designate every dollar of income to a particular task. Its "Age of Money" metric shows how long dollars sit in your account before being spent, which assists you construct a buffer in between earning and spending. Goal tracking, age of money metric, budget plan templates, direct bank sync via Plaid, educational resources, and an encouraging neighborhood.

It needs Plaid for automated imports, which indicates sharing bank qualifications with a third party. There is no complimentary tier after the trial duration ends. You definitely can save money successfully without ever linking your savings account to a budgeting app, and there are strong privacy and security factors to consider this method. Apps like SenticMoney and GoodBudget work totally without bank connections. SenticMoney also supports importing bank statements as CSV, OFX, QFX, Excel, or PDF files, which provides you the convenience of bulk deal import without sharing your login qualifications.

APFSCAPFSC


The Federal Reserve's Study of Family Economics has actually recorded growing customer issue about sharing bank qualifications with third-party services. With local-first apps, your financial history exists just on your gadget. If the app business gets hacked, your transaction information is not exposed because it was never on their servers. By hand going into or reviewing deals makes you more conscious of your spending patterns.

Local-first apps function without an internet connection, so you can track costs and examine budgets anywhere. The import workflow with SenticMoney is simple: log into your bank site, download your statement as a CSV, Excel, OFX, QFX, or PDF file, and import it into SenticMoney. The app has 15+ bank presets (Chase, Bank of America, Wells Fargo, Citi, Capital One, United States Bank, PNC, TD Bank, Ally, Discover, Amex, Navy Federal, USAA, Schwab, and Fidelity) that immediately map columns, plus custom-made CSV mapping for any other organization.

For individuals who want even more hands-on engagement, SenticMoney's totally free tier supports limitless manual transaction entry. Combined with spending plan tracking and the Financial Health Rating, you have a complete cost savings system that never touches the web.
